summ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--core/java/android/view/ViewRoot.java3
1 files changed, 3 insertions, 0 deletions
diff --git a/core/java/android/view/ViewRoot.java b/core/java/android/view/ViewRoot.java
index 17d413a5eb44..5f3184defef1 100644
--- a/core/java/android/view/ViewRoot.java
+++ b/core/java/android/view/ViewRoot.java
@@ -586,6 +586,9 @@ public final class ViewRoot extends Handler implements ViewParent,
dirty.inset(-1, -1);
}
}
+ if (!mDirty.isEmpty()) {
+ mAttachInfo.mIgnoreDirtyState = true;
+ }
mDirty.union(dirty);
if (!mWillDrawSoon) {
scheduleTraversals();